What is Vivid Sydney?

Vivid Sydney is Australia’s largest and most spectacular festival of light, music, ideas, and food, transforming the city into a vibrant canvas! The festival takes place across iconic parts of the city: Circular Quay & The Rocks, Barangaroo, Darling Harbor, The Goods Line, CBD, and Martin Place (for the first time since 2018), each offering unique projections and immersive light walks.
Last year, around 2.3 million visitors experienced Vivid Sydney and the festival was awarded the Best Cultural, Arts, or Music Event at the Australian Event Awards!

Is Vivid Sydney Free?
While there is no free drone show this year, over 75% of Vivid Sydney 2025 is free! Some of the free events include the Light Walk across all regions, Tumbalong Nights (every Saturday at 5 pm), free gigs like Metri Air x Vivid Sydney across all locations (every Wednesday night), I Dream of Reality (a VR experience), Flower’s Power across Martin Place and Colour the City!

2. David McDiarmid’s “Kiss of Light”
📌Opera House

An artist, designer, and a voice for gays back in the 90s, David Mcdiarmids’ work encompasses the complex and interconnected histories of art, craft, fashion, music, sex, gay liberation, and identity politics, and on the 30th anniversary of his death, Vivid Syndey is bringing Lighting of Sails: Kiss of Light, a beautiful projection onto the Opera House showcasing the experiences of a repressed minority while embodying complex truths, absorbing fear and preserving memory.
You can see this 7-minute display every night at the Opera House and it costs to penny!
3. Vincent Namatjira’s “King Dingo”
📌Museum Of Contemporary Art

Vincent Namatjira’s King Dingo is a bold multimedia projection that challenges Australia’s colonial past and envisions a future of cultural reclamation! Using the dingo, a First Nations totem (animal), as a symbol of power! Accompanied by an original score by Jeremy Whiskey, this work fuses humor, striking imagery, and music to assert Aboriginal strength and unity.
King Dingo represents a timely and powerful message: this is Aboriginal land, we always have been and always will be! It speaks to Vivid Sydney’s 2025 theme, Dream, offering a vision of full recognition and respect for Aboriginal culture, a dream that Namatjira hopes will become reality for future generations!
4. Romance Was Born’s “House of Romance”
📌Customs House

Celebrate 20 years of Romance Was Born with House of Romance: Dreams Collide, their debut Vivid Sydney projection at Customs House! This engrossing experience showcases the duo’s creative journey, bringing to life iconic looks from their collections and collaborations with renowned Australian artists like Ken Done, Del Kathryn Barton, and Jenny Kee!
We are expecting vibrant colors, whimsical designs, and an unforgettable dreamscape with this one through the digital artistry by Supergiant and a custom soundtrack by Heckler Sound! House of Romance is a tribute to two decades of fearless creativity and imagination in Australian fashion!

8. Refettorio OzHarvest’s Our Shared Dream
📌481 Crown Streets, Surry Hills

Are you someone who is passionate about food sustainability and reducing waste? Our Shared Dream, A World With Zero Waste, is an event you won’t want to miss! This series of seven special dinners in Sydney brings together top Australian chefs and OzHarvest to craft unique four-course menus using rescued NSW produce. For every ticket sold, a meal is provided to someone in need! Tickets cost around $110 per person.

Is Vivid Sydney Worth Visiting? Tips and More!
Of course! Vivid is one of the best times to visit Sydney to explore the beauty of this harbor city! We highly recommend exploring Vivid Sydney as much as you can! Here are a few ways in which you could make the most of it:
➡️ Explore one zone at a time: Don’t try to see everything at once—Vivid Sydney is best enjoyed at a relaxed pace! Focus on one zone per day or take your time exploring a single location over multiple evenings. For a smoother experience, visit on weekdays after work to avoid the weekend crowds.
➡️ Avoid weekends and/or start early: If you’re bringing little ones, weekdays are your best bet! Weekends get packed, with long queues for installations and events, which can be tiring and overwhelming for kids.
➡️ Pre-book, especially for free events: If there’s a ticketed event you’ve been eyeing, book it early before it sells out! Many free events also require pre-registration, so check the Vivid Sydney website in advance.
➡️ Use public transport: Road closures and traffic make parking in the city quite tricky! We recommend using public transport to get around the city and enjoy all the installations and experiences across a few days.

When is Vivid Sydney 2025?
Vivid Sydney 2025 is a 23-day-long festival from May 23 to June 14 this year! As winter sets in, we recommend layering up to stay warm while you explore the dazzling lights and immersive experiences.
Where to Park for Vivid Sydney?
Parking during Vivid Sydney is extremely limited due to road closures and special event clearways across all five major precincts.
The festival is designed to be explored on foot, and with massive crowds, driving can be more hassle than it’s worth. To make your experience smoother (and cheaper!), we highly recommend using public transport instead!
When is the Vivid Sydney Drone Show in 2025?

Unfortunately, the drone show has been canceled for 2025 (mainly due to safety reasons)! Don’t lower your expectations though, there is a lot to look forward to in Vivid Sydney 2025!
